The Official Step-by-Step Process
Getting a Class B (basic car) chauffeur's license in Norway involves numerous mandatory phases. Avoiding any of these steps is not permitted.
[Traffic Basic Course] ➔ [Necessary Training] ➔ [Theoretical Exam] ➔ [Practical Driving Test] ➔ [License Issued]1. Traffic Basic Course (Trafikalt grunnkurs)
This is the mandatory initial step for anyone under the age of 25 (and advised for all).
Duration: 17 hours.Material: Introduces fundamental roadway traffic guidelines, very first aid, and driving in the dark (mørkekjøring).Requirement: Must be completed before any useful driving lessons can start on public roads.2. Basic Vehicle and Driving Training
Discovering to drive safely requires mastering numerous environments and vehicle controls.
Expert Instruction: While practice driving with a private supervisor (ledsager) is enabled, students need to finish necessary lessons with a qualified traffic school (trafikkskole).Necessary Modules: These consist of safety courses on practice roadways (glattkjøring), proficiency assessments, and long-distance driving.3. The Theoretical Exam (Teoritentamen)
Before scheduling the practical driving test, candidates should pass a computer-based theory test at a Statens vegvesen traffic station.
Format: Multiple-choice concerns covering traffic signs, guidelines of the roadway, ecological considerations, and car mechanics.Preparation: Applicants are motivated to study main handbooks and take practice tests thoroughly.4. The Practical Driving Test (Praktisk førerprøve)
The final obstacle is the practical driving test, conducted with an official sensing unit (examiner) from the general public Roads Administration.
Vehicle Check: The examiner will ask the candidate to inspect specific components of the vehicle (e.g., brakes, lights, fluid levels) before beginning.The Drive: The test lasts roughly 45-- 60 minutes and assesses the candidate's capability to drive safely, individually, and effectively in varying traffic conditions.Approximated Costs of a Norwegian Driver's License
Norway is known for having a few of the most costly motorist's training on the planet. Because everything is modular and tailored to individual development, expenses vary commonly.
Training ComponentEstimated Cost (NOK)Estimated Cost (GBP/EUR Equivalent)Traffic Basic Course3,000-- 5,000 kr~ ₤ 300-- ₤ 500Necessary Safety Courses8,000-- 12,000 kr~ ₤ 800-- ₤ 1,200Specific Driving Lessons (per hour)800-- 1,100 kr~ ₤ 80-- ₤ 110 per hourExaminations & & Administration Fees4,000-- 6,000 kr~ ₤ 400-- ₤ 600Overall Average Cost30,000-- 50,000+ kr~ ₤ 3,000-- ₤ 5,000+
Note: Students who practice extensively with friend or family outside of driving school usually invest closer to the lower end of the spectrum, while those relying entirely on professional instructors will trend toward the greater end.

What is the minimum age to get a vehicle license in Norway?
The minimum age to take the practical driving test for a standard vehicle (Class B) is 18. However, you can start taking the traffic fundamental course and private driving lessons at age 16.
Is the theory test offered in English?
Yes. When reserving your theory examination through Statens vegvesen, you can choose to take the test in either Norwegian or English.
